Sixty Six**                                                                       
(GB/Fra 2006)
Universal/Working Title Films/Studio Canal/WT2. 93m.

In 1966 a young Jewish boy fears that his bar mitzvah will be ruined by England reaching the World Cup Final on July 30th.
Nostalgically evoked childhood memoir, giving way increasingly to sentiment after an amusing start. Lots of good, authentic period detail.

Written by: Bridget O'Connor, Peter Straughan, from a story by Paul Weiland.
Producers: Tim Bevan, Eric Fellner, Elizabeth Karlsen.
Director: Paul Weiland.
Starring: Gregg Sulkin, Eddie Marsan, Helena Bonham Carter, Peter Serafinowicz, Catherine Tate, Stephen Rea, Richard Katz, Geraldine Somerville.
Photography: Daniel Landin.
Music: Joby Talbot.
Editing: Paul Tothill.
Production Design: Michael Howells.
